CCProxy features and specs

  • Ease of Use
    CCProxy offers an intuitive user interface that simplifies the process of setting up and configuring proxy servers, making it accessible even for users with limited technical expertise.
  • Multi-Protocol Support
    The software supports a wide range of protocols including HTTP, HTTPS, FTP, and more, allowing it to cater to diverse networking needs.
  • User Management
    CCProxy provides robust user management features, enabling administrators to efficiently control and monitor user activities and bandwidth usage.
  • Access Control
    It includes access control functionalities that allow admins to block unwanted sites and set internet access restrictions based on IP addresses or domains.
  • Cache Management
    The software offers effective caching mechanisms to improve internet browsing speed and reduce bandwidth consumption by storing frequently accessed data.

Possible disadvantages of CCProxy

  • Windows Only
    CCProxy is only compatible with Windows operating systems, which could be a limitation for users who operate on macOS or Linux platforms.
  • Limited Free Version
    The free version of CCProxy has restricted functionalities, encouraging users to purchase the full version for comprehensive features.
  • Scalability Issues
    For larger enterprises, CCProxy might lack the advanced scalability features that are necessary to efficiently handle large volumes of traffic.
  • Basic Reporting
    The reporting and analytics features are relatively basic, which might not meet the requirements of organizations seeking in-depth network analysis.
  • Customer Support
    The availability and responsiveness of technical support could be improved to provide faster assistance for troubleshooting and user queries.
